You did an amazing job with the design! I am in awe! Are you still happy with your pebble choice? I'm trying to decide on mine and don't want to go too dark. Can you easily see the bottom of the pool in the deep end?

Thank you! Yes, I can easily see the bottom, but its only 5.5 ft deep. I remember losing sleep over my pebble choice, but my PB suggested the darker color. I love that changes color with the sun and had the abalone shells included in the mix. To me, its even more beautiful whe the water is still and I can see the individual pebbles. Good luck! :)
 
Im very happy with it! Im not sure the actual name of the color, but it is NOT the "rainbow" color. I remember they had 2 or 3 to choose from and I chose the lightest one. The Rainbow was pretty, but it had more colored stones. I wanted the brown tones. I find it not to be slick and easy to walk on. I also think it'll hide any cracks better, as theyre bound to happen under clay soil. Hope this helps!
